  • Cards are often overused and unnecessary in design.
  • Gestalt principles, like proximity and common region, can replace cards for better results.
  • Cards take up extra space, add cognitive burden, and can conceal poor content organization.
  • Proximity principle suggests internal spacing should not exceed external spacing for better grouping.
  • Cards are appropriate for CTAs or complex layouts where distinction is hard with spacing alone.
  • Ordering spacing thoughtfully can lead to better design outcomes than defaulting to cards.
